  89. // PS/2 mouse data is '9-bit integer'(-256 to 255) which is comprised of sign-bit and 8-bit value.
  90. // bit: 8 7 ... 0
  91. // sign \8-bit/
  92. //
  93. // Meanwhile USB HID mouse indicates 8bit data(-127 to 127), note that -128 is not used.
  94. //
  95. // This converts PS/2 data into HID value. Use only -127-127 out of PS/2 9-bit.
  96. mouse_report.x = X_IS_NEG ?
  97. ((!X_IS_OVF && -127 <= mouse_report.x && mouse_report.x <= -1) ? mouse_report.x : -127) :
  98. ((!X_IS_OVF && 0 <= mouse_report.x && mouse_report.x <= 127) ? mouse_report.x : 127);
  99. mouse_report.y = Y_IS_NEG ?
  100. ((!Y_IS_OVF && -127 <= mouse_report.y && mouse_report.y <= -1) ? mouse_report.y : -127) :
  101. ((!Y_IS_OVF && 0 <= mouse_report.y && mouse_report.y <= 127) ? mouse_report.y : 127);
  102. // remove sign and overflow flags
  103. mouse_report.buttons &= PS2_MOUSE_BTN_MASK;
  104. // invert coordinate of y to conform to USB HID mouse
  105. mouse_report.y = -mouse_report.y;

  158. /* PS/2 Mouse Synopsis
  159. * http://www.computer-engineering.org/ps2mouse/
  160. *
  161. * Command:
  162. * 0xFF: Reset
  163. * 0xF6: Set Defaults Sampling; rate=100, resolution=4cnt/mm, scaling=1:1, reporting=disabled
  164. * 0xF5: Disable Data Reporting
  165. * 0xF4: Enable Data Reporting
  166. * 0xF3: Set Sample Rate
  167. * 0xF2: Get Device ID
  168. * 0xF0: Set Remote Mode
  169. * 0xEB: Read Data
  170. * 0xEA: Set Stream Mode
  171. * 0xE9: Status Request
  172. * 0xE8: Set Resolution
  173. * 0xE7: Set Scaling 2:1
  174. * 0xE6: Set Scaling 1:1
  175. *
  176. * Mode:
  177. * Stream Mode: devices sends the data when it changs its state
  178. * Remote Mode: host polls the data periodically
  179. *
  180. * This code uses Remote Mode and polls the data with Read Data(0xEB).
  181. *
  182. * Data format:
  183. * byte|7 6 5 4 3 2 1 0
  184. * ----+--------------------------------------------------------------
  185. * 0|Yovflw Xovflw Ysign Xsign 1 Middle Right Left
  186. * 1| X movement
  187. * 2| Y movement
  188. */
